Licensing Coordinator
Houston, TXMarch 26th, 2026
Our client, a music-licensing non-profit, is seeking a Long-Term Temporary Licensing Coordinator to join their team ASAP (as soon as we find the right people). This is a fully open-ended temp contract with potential to convert to perm down the line if it's a mutual fit. The hours are 9am-5pm with an hour-long unpaid lunch break. This role is a hybrid schedule - 3 days/week onsite, 2 days/week remote. The hourly pay rate is $26.50/hr. Key Responsibilities: Understand and interpret license agreements and terms Manage compliance and collection activities according to established processes Provide administrative support to Resolution Managers and Key Account Managers Respond to licensee/customer inquiries and provide guidance on licensing portals Research and update contact and account information Maintain accurate records in ASCAP systems (e.g., CRM, invoicing, customer activity) Handle special projects as assigned Qualifications: Bachelor's degree required 1-2 years of experience in an administrative or customer service role Exposure to contracts or licensing agreements is strongly preferred Experience in licensing, sales, or business development (music/media industry a plus) Strong verbal and written communication skills Highly organized and detail-oriented Comfortable using Word, Excel, and CRM platforms (Salesforce preferred) Self-motivated, reliable, and proactive Professional demeanor and ability to communicate effectively across all levels Beacon Hill is an equal opportunity employer and individuals with disabilities and/or protected veterans are encouraged to apply.
